VWG sales surge in September

The Volkswagen Group has reported a 9.2% rise in global deliveries during September 2019 compared to the same month last year. It delivered 904,200 vehicles to customers.

In a shrinking overall global market, the Group continued to significantly expand its market shares. As expected, this development was driven by Europe (31%) and Germany (58.1%). Here, deliveries had been at an unusually low level in September 2018 as a result of restricted vehicle availability following the changeover to the new WLTP type approval procedure.

In North America and Asia-Pacific, the Volkswagen Group succeeded in slightly expanding its market shares in shrinking overall markets.

In South America, the Group markedly boosted deliveries in contrast to the decreasing overall market and therefore significantly expanded its market share.

Dr. Christian Dahlheim, head of Volkswagen Group sales, said, ‘In the current economic and geopolitical environment, which is tense, our strong brands are once again proving to be especially valuable. They offer our customers security for their purchasing decisions and therefore lay the foundation for the continual expansion of our global market share.’
